Binance is one of the largest and most popular cryptocurrency exchanges in the world, offering a wide range of services for trading digital assets. To trade smarter on Binance, consider the following tips and strategies:
### 1. **Understand the Basics** - **Learn the Platform**: Familiarize yourself with Binance's interface, including spot trading, futures trading, margin trading, and other features. - **Know the Markets**: Understand the different types of cryptocurrencies, their use cases, and market behavior.
### 2. **Use Binance Academy** - Binance Academy offers free educational resources on blockchain, cryptocurrencies, and trading strategies. Utilize these resources to enhance your knowledge.
### 3. **Start with a Demo Account** - If you're new to trading, consider using Binance's demo trading feature to practice without risking real money.
### 4. **Diversify Your Portfolio** - Avoid putting all your funds into a single cryptocurrency. Diversify your investments to spread risk.
### 5. **Set Clear Goals and Strategies** - **Define Your Goals**: Are you trading for short-term gains or long-term investment? - **Choose a Strategy**: Common strategies include day trading, swing trading, and HODLing (holding long-term).
### 6. **Use Stop-Loss and Take-Profit Orders** - **Stop-Loss**: Automatically sell a cryptocurrency when it reaches a certain price to limit losses. - **Take-Profit**: Automatically sell a cryptocurrency when it reaches a certain price to lock in profits.
### 7. **Leverage Technical Analysis** - Use charts and indicators (e.g., Moving Averages, RSI, MACD) to analyze price movements and make informed decisions.
### 8. **Stay Updated with News** - Follow cryptocurrency news and updates. Market sentiment can be heavily influenced by news events, regulatory changes, and technological developments.
### 9. **Risk Management** - Only invest what you can afford to lose. - Avoid emotional trading; stick to your strategy.
### 10. **Use Binance Tools** - **Binance Smart Pool**: Optimize your mining efforts. - **Binance Earn**: Earn interest on your crypto holdings. - **Binance Savings**: Lock your funds to earn interest over time.
### 11. **Security Measures** -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) to secure your account. - Use strong, unique passwords and consider using a hardware wallet for large amounts of cryptocurrency.
### 12. **Join the Community** - Participate in Binance's community forums, social media channels, and local communities to learn from other traders and stay updated.
### 13. **Monitor Market Trends** - Keep an eye on market trends and be ready to adapt your strategy as needed.
### 14. **Avoid Overtrading** - Overtrading can lead to significant losses due to fees and emotional decision-making. Stick to your plan and avoid making impulsive trades.
### 15. **Use Binance API for Advanced Trading** - If you're an advanced trader, consider using Binance's API to automate your trading strategies.
### 16. **Stay Compliant** - Ensure you are aware of and comply with the regulations in your country regarding cryptocurrency trading.
By following these tips and continuously educating yourself, you can trade smarter and more effectively on Binance. Remember, trading involves risk, and it's important to approach it with caution and a well-thought-out plan. $XRP $BNB

Predicting whether Pepe (PEPE) or Shiba Inu (SHIB) will reach $0.001 by 2025 involves considering several factors, including market trends, adoption, tokenomics, and overall cryptocurrency market conditions. Here's a breakdown of the possibilities:
---
### **1. Current Market Context** - **Shiba Inu (SHIB):** As of October 2023, SHIB is trading at around $0.000007 to $0.000008. To reach $0.001, SHIB would need to increase by approximately **12,500x** from its current price. - **Pepe (PEPE):** PEPE is trading at around $0.0000007 to $0.0000008. To reach $0.001, it would need to increase by approximately **1,250,000x**.

Challenges to Reach $0.001** #### **For Shiba Inu (SHIB):** - **Market Cap Requirement:** For SHIB to reach $0.001, its market cap would need to grow to around **$590 billion** (assuming no significant token burns). This is more than twice the market cap of Bitcoin in 2023. - **Token Supply:** SHIB has a massive circulating supply (around 589 trillion tokens), which makes it difficult for the price to rise significantly without massive demand or token burns. - **Utility and Adoption:** SHIB would need to see widespread adoption as a payment method or in decentralized finance (DeFi) to drive demand.
#### **For Pepe (PEPE):** - **Market Cap Requirement:** For PEPE to reach $0.001, its market cap would need to grow to around **$420 billion**, which is highly unrealistic given its current position. - **Token Supply:** PEPE also has a very high circulating supply, making it challenging for the price to rise significantly. - **Competition:** PEPE faces intense competition from other meme coins like SHIB and Dogecoin (DOGE), which have stronger brand recognition and communities. ### **3. A "virtual whale" in the context of cryptocurrency refers to an individual or entity that holds a significant amount of a particular cryptocurrency. These large holders can influence the market due to the sheer volume of their holdings. Here are some key points about virtual whales:
1. **Market Influence**: Whales can impact the price of a cryptocurrency by buying or selling large amounts. Their actions can lead to significant price swings, either upwards or downwards.
2. **Visibility**: While blockchain transactions are transparent, the identities of whales are often unknown. They can be early adopters, institutional investors, or even exchanges.
3. **Strategies**: Whales might use their holdings to manipulate the market. For example, they might engage in "pump and dump" schemes, where they buy large amounts to drive the price up and then sell off their holdings at the peak.
4. **Risk and Reward**: Holding large amounts of cryptocurrency can be risky due to market volatility. However, whales can also reap substantial rewards if the value of their holdings increases significantly.
5. **Regulation**: Regulatory bodies are increasingly paying attention to the activities of whales to prevent market manipulation and ensure fair trading practices.
Understanding the behavior of whales can be crucial for other investors, as their actions can provide insights into market trends . $XRP $BNB

Gas fees play a crucial role in the operation of blockchain networks, especially those utilizing smart contracts like Ethereum. Here’s how gas fees impact the cryptocurrency ecosystem:
1. **Transaction Prioritization**: Higher gas fees can prioritize a transaction, allowing it to be processed quicker. During network congestion, users may increase their gas fees to ensure their transactions are confirmed promptly.
2. **User Behavior**: Fluctuating gas fees can significantly affect user behavior. When fees are high, users might delay transactions, resulting in lower trading volumes and decreased market activity. Conversely, low fees encourage more transactions.
3. **DeFi Activity**: Gas fees are particularly impactful in decentralized finance (DeFi). High fees can deter users from participating in trading, lending, or borrowing, affecting the overall liquidity and usability of DeFi protocols.
4. **NFT Transactions**: Non-fungible tokens (NFTs) often incur higher gas fees during minting or purchasing times of high demand. This can affect user interest and participation in NFT markets.
5. **Network Congestion**: Gas fees tend to rise during peak usage times, reflecting network congestion. In extreme cases, high fees can lead users to switch to other blockchains with lower transaction costs, impacting the original network’s user base.
6. **Incentive Structures**: Miners earn gas fees as a reward for processing transactions. High fees can incentivize more miners to participate in the network, increasing its security.
7. **Financial Planning**: Investors and traders must factor in gas fees when executing trades or transferring assets. Unexpected high fees can result in losses or erode profits, especially for smaller transactions.
8. **Interoperability and Cross-Chain Transactions**: As users explore cross-chain solutions, differing gas fee structures can complicate transactions. Users may favor blockchains with lower fees, impacting multi-chain adoption.
9. **Governance and Improvement Proposals**: High gas fees often lead to community discussions about upgrading protocols. Proposals aim to improve efficiency or lower costs, impacting long-term network utility.
10. **User Accessibility**: High gas fees can exclude smaller investors or users with limited funds from participating in certain transactions. This can lead to reduced market diversity and accessibility.
In summary, gas fees are a vital component impacting transaction speed, user behavior, participation in DeFi and NFTs, network congestion, and overall accessibility in the crypto space. Keeping abreast of gas fee trends can help you make more informed decisions in your cryptocurrency activities. $XRP $BNB
Analyzing wallet activity in cryptocurrency can provide valuable insights into market sentiment, investor behavior, and potential price movements.
1. **Transaction Volume**: Monitoring the number of transactions from a wallet can indicate how actively investors are trading. Increased transaction volume may suggest heightened interest in a particular asset.
2. **Wallet Age**: The age of a wallet can provide insights into whether the assets are being held long-term or actively traded. Older wallets might indicate long-term holders, while newer wallets could suggest speculation.
3. **Balance Increases/Decreases**: Significant increases in a wallet’s balance may indicate accumulation, while rapid decreases might suggest selling pressure. Tracking these movements can provide clues about investor sentiment.
4. **Whale Activity**: Large wallets, often referred to as "whales," can heavily influence market prices. If a whale moves a substantial amount of tokens, it might signal a price change.
5. **Distribution of Tokens**: Analyzing how tokens are distributed across wallets can reveal concentration or decentralization. A high concentration in a few wallets could lead to market manipulation risks.
6. **Smart Contract Interactions**: If a wallet interacts with popular DeFi protocols or platforms, it might indicate trends in liquidity, yield farming, or staking, influencing broader market sentiment.
7. **Transfer Patterns**: Examining the frequency and size of transfers between wallets can uncover patterns. Repeatedly transferring tokens between certain wallets might indicate strategic positioning.
8. **On-chain Metrics**: Other on-chain metrics, such as the number of active addresses and transactions over time, can provide a broader view of network health and investor engagement.
9. **Token Burns and Migrations**: If a project is burning tokens or migrating to new contracts, monitoring wallet activity can help understand community response and investor sentiment regarding these changes.
10. **Market Reaction**: Watching wallet activity around significant news events or announcements can reveal how quickly investors react, which can help assess overall market sentiment.
By analyzing these aspects of wallet activity, you can gain insights into market trends, identify potential opportunities, and better understand investor behavior. $BNB $XRP

Token movement signals are indicators that can help traders and investors anticipate price changes in cryptocurrencies based on the movement of tokens. Here are key signals to consider:
1. **Large Transactions**: Sudden large transfers of tokens to exchanges may indicate impending selling pressure, while large transfers from exchanges could suggest accumulation.
2. **Whale Activity**: Monitoring the activity of "whales" (large holders) can provide insights. Significant buying or selling from whales often influences market prices.
3. **Token Burns**: When a project burns tokens (permanently removes them from circulation), it can signal scarcity, potentially leading to price appreciation.
4. **Wallet Distribution Changes**: Changes in token distribution among wallets can indicate shifts in investor sentiment. If many tokens move to a few addresses, it might suggest accumulation by a few investors.
5. **On-chain Analysis**: Analyzing on-chain data, such as transaction volume and active addresses, can provide insights into token movement and overall network health.
6. **Exchange Flow**: Monitoring net inflow (tokens moving to exchanges) and outflow (tokens moving away) can indicate market sentiment. High inflows may suggest bearish sentiment, while high outflows may signal bullish sentiment.
7. **Smart Contract Activity**: Significant activity in associated smart contracts (particularly in DeFi) can indicate increased interest or functionality, influencing token price.
8. **Market Cap and Volume**: Sudden changes in market capitalization and trading volume can signal upcoming price movements, drawing attention to tokens experiencing unusual activity.
9. **Timely Transactions**: Studying transaction timings around major announcements or events can provide clues about market expectations and potential price reactions.
By monitoring these signals, traders can gain insights into market trends and potential price movements. However, it's essential to use these signals in conjunction with other analytical tools for more accurate predictions. $BNB $XRP

Price trend analysis in cryptocurrency involves assessing historical price movements and patterns to predict future price changes. Here are key concepts to consider:
1. **Technical Analysis**: Use charts and technical indicators (e.g., moving averages, RSI, MACD) to identify trends and potential reversal points.
2. **Support and Resistance Levels**: Identify key price levels where a cryptocurrency tends to find support (floor prices) or resistance (ceiling prices).
3. **Volume Analysis**: Observe trading volume to confirm trends. Increasing volume in an uptrend indicates strength, while decreasing volume can signify weakness.
4. **Market Sentiment**: Gauge market mood through news, social media, and investor behavior. Positive news can drive prices up, while negative news might lead to declines.
5. **Fundamental Analysis**: Analyze the underlying factors affecting the cryptocurrency, such as technology, regulatory news, and macroeconomic trends.
6. **Chart Patterns**: Look for patterns such as head and shoulders, flags, and triangles, which can indicate potential future price movements.
7. **Long-term vs. Short-term Trends**: Differentiate between macro-trends (long-term direction) and micro-trends (short-term fluctuations).
To perform a detailed price trend analysis, you would typically use historical price data and apply these techniques, keeping in mind the volatile nature of the crypto market. $XRP $BNB
